Reporting to the Production Manager, the Cleaning Technician has a basic understanding of restoration techniques used in cleaning content and structures is preferred. Duties will include structural cleaning as well as content packing, listing, photographing, manipulation and restorative cleaning; however will lend assistance to other divisions in (minor) demolition,
debris disposal, poly and prep containment set up and removal.
**Job Duties**
* Provide sound cleaning practices at customer job sites and in the warehouse for content processing, including but not limited to packing, listing, photographing, manipulating, and transporting content when necessary
* Process all content according to industry standards and regardless of their condition ensuring they are returned to the customer or disposed of as directed by the Project Manager
* Provide sound cleaning practices at customer job sites for structures, including but not limited to poly and prep set up and take down, cleaning ceiling, walls, doors, baseboard, casing, counter tops, fixtures, floors and appliances as required
* Erect and disassemble scaffolding when required
* Ensure all Health and Safety policies and procedures are adhered to
* Familiarity with chemical products, including use, disposal and Safety Data Sheets application
* Provide excellent customer service
* Work under time constraints to meet specific timelines
* Ensure attention to detail and keen sense of safeguarding other people’s property and information
* Will practice good housekeeping at all times to ensure a safe and non-cluttered worksite
* Participates in and demonstrates an understanding of safety principles and practices; follows all safety policies and procedures to support a safe working environment, including safe operation of machines and equipment
* Comply with all **Belfor** policies and procedures, as well as legislative requirements
* Proactively communicate job site conditions and concerns that may or are affecting completion of the job to the appropriate person
* This role could be required to act as a “lead” periodically as designated by their manager
* Attend all **Belfor** sponsored training courses
* Perform moisture mapping, water extraction, mould remediation, cleaning of affected surfaces,
and demolition and removal of building materials to support the restoration process, adhering to
IICRC guidelines;
* Photograph and document all restoration-related work throughout the restoration project;
